Q: The stale-branch cleanup bot (Tidybranch) deleted a branch someone still needed — what do I do?
A: Tidybranch archives every branch for 90 days before permanent deletion, so nothing is lost immediately. Restore it from the archive panel in the Hollyfork admin console. If the console itself is locked because the bot's service account tripped the anomaly detector, you can unlock the restore flow with the recovery passphrase below.

vault phrase of tajef-tafog = istox-sorax-zorox-casok-holox-kelix-weneth-drueth-casion

## Environments: Bulk edits in the admin table

Quick heads-up for reviewers: the Fernwhistle admin console now supports bulk edits on the tenants table, but only in staging and sandbox — prod deliberately caps batch size at one until the audit hooks land. If you're reviewing a PR that touches the bulk-edit path, check that it respects the per-environment row limits and that dry-run mode stays the default. Each environment gets its own limits, and the staging instance currently runs with the configuration values below.

config for tagep-yajef:
ulawyn:
  log_level: error
  metrics_host: metrics.ulawyn.lumiclabs.internal
  pin: 0564
  pool_size: 32

Handover — Facilities Desk. Renwick Property Group audits Calder House Thursday, 08:00. Their assessor walks floors 2–4 plus plant room. Keep corridors clear of pallets; the Velgro shipment must move to storage by Wednesday night. Fire doors propped open on 3 — fix before they arrive. Log any defects they flag straight into the Torvane tracker, not email. Escort required at all times; meet them at the east lobby. Use the following pass for the plant room.

turnstile pass: bdg-YPPQB-52010

Leadership Review Briefing — Vextra Licensing Dispute

Quick heads-up before Thursday's session: Corlan Systems is still contesting our right to bundle the Vextra toolkit with Pathlight Pro, claiming the 2021 agreement covered standalone sales only. Legal thinks our position is solid but expects another sixty days of back-and-forth. Meanwhile, we've paused new Vextra-bundled quotes in the Ardmore region to keep things tidy. Before we decide on escalation, everyone should see where this sits against our plans.

confidential, kagup-bafog: Fraaxax Group is in early talks to buy Soroxox Group for about $343.8 million. The Olidor launch date is June 14, and nothing goes to the press before then. Legal wants the Aldmirek Logistics term sheet signed before July 23.